The flight distance from National Airport (BRU) to Chengdu Airport (CTU) is 4989 miles. This is equivalent to 8029 kilometers or 4333 nautical miles. The distance shown below is the straight line distance (may be called as flying or air distance) or direct flight distance between airports.
8029 kilometers is the distance from National Airport, Belgium to Chengdu Airport, China.
Flight Duration between Brussels, Belgium and Chengdu, China
Estimated flight time from National Airport, Brussels, Belgium to Chengdu Airport, Chengdu, China is 9 hours 59 minutes under avarage conditions. The flight time calculator assumes an average flight speed for a commercial airliner of 500 mph, which is equivalent to 805 km/hr or 434 knots. Your actual flying time may vary depending on wind speeds or weather conditions.
